Factors that may be beyond both your and the specialist's control need to be taken right into account. In basic, Sweeten renovators report that their cooking area restorations are completed between three weeks to 2 months (relying on the degree of intricacy). The essential to remaining on track is isolating the steps that you think may be challenges and allotting even more time to get them done.

Kitchen Bath Remodeling Contractors Near Me Orinda CA

For comparison, Houzz's 2024 Home Research (based on a survey of greater than 32,000 users) discovered that cooking area restorations averaged 9.6 months of planning and 5.1 months of structure in 2023 - Bath Remodeling Trends Contra Costa County. That adds up to almost 15 months when both are combined. The distinction boils down to 2 points: how the job is managed, and just how quickly a homeowner moves via decisions.

The Houzz figure (9.6 months of preparation plus 5.1 months of structure) mirrors what homeowners in fact experience when they run the process themselves. Homeowner-managed tasks have a tendency to entail: Extended decision cycles with several rounds of style conferences and alterations before anything is secured Gaps in between style conclusion and specialist hiring Longer permitting home windows brought on by incomplete plan entries or sluggish applicant actions Re-selection cycles when first item choices review spending plan or get ceased Contractor scheduling home windows that rely on the existing stockpile Functioning with a design-build company compresses this timeline due to the fact that layout, item option, permitting, and building scheduling occur within a single process instead of throughout separate agreements
